After serving in the Navy during World War II, Anderson returned to helm one of the greatest dynasties in high school football history, highlighted by a stretch from 1946 to 1957, when Montclair won 102 games and lost 4. Marcus Hackett A 1980 Immaculate Conception graduate, Hackett played wide receiver for Syracuse University and went on to play for the New Jersey Generals of the United States Football League in 1984 and 1985. Garvie Craw A fullback and key member of the 1964 Montclair squad, arguably the best team in program history, Craw went on to have a very successful career as a fullback/halfback for the University of Michigan in 1967-1969. David Caldwell A 2005 graduate, Caldwell spent a postgrad year at Lawrenceville and played for William & Mary, eventually signing with the NFLs Indianapolis Colts as an undrafted free agent in 2010. Gus Keriazokos This former Montclair High School athlete had two stints in the Major leagues, playing for the Chicago White Sox in 1950 and then reappearing to pitch for the Washington Senators in 1954, and Kansas City Athletics in 1955. .
